Before spending serious money on things like audio cables, I think most audiophiles have already experimented with them first. It's very common for audio dealers to hand a customer some used cable with a request that he try it in his system. No cost, no obligation. Many a skeptical audiophile has been surprised at the result, and the sale follows that. So in those instances, it's not the result of "confirmation bias."

Moreover, confirmation bias is not ordinarily found in an experiment that focuses on empirical data. It is found in pseudo science that seeks to pass itself off as veracity.
To the extent that confirmation bias exists, it is found everywhere, and the results of listening tests are themselves "empirical data."

You can't quantify listening skills ... You can give hearing tests to determine the frequencies people can hear, but you certainly cannot attach a number to what they can hear when listening to subtle music which is comprised of always changing frequencies from multiple different instruments.
This is completely mistaken. Many who have used double-blind listening tests - such as in designing audio codecs - absolutely have ranked listener acuity, usually after a training period to help them understand what they should be listening for in the test.
